Summary

This collection of inspirational titles for students includes three ebooks by some of today's most engaging voices. 
Not a Fan Student Edition, by bestselling author Kyle Idleman: Are you treating Jesus the same as the other people you admire? Kyle Idleman uses humor, personal stories, and biblical truth as he challenges you to look at what it means to call yourself a Christian and follow the radical call Jesus presents. 
The Circle Maker Student Edition, by New York Times bestselling authors Mark Batterson and Parker Batterson: How do you approach the maker of the world, and what exactly can you pray for? Mark Batterson uses the true legend of Honi the circle maker, a Jewish sage whose bold prayer saved a generation, to uncover the boldness God asks of us at times, and what powerful prayer can mean in your life. 
Thrive Student Edition, by Casting Crowns member Mark Hall: What does that phrase "live out your faith" really mean? And how do you really follow Jesus in today's world? Mark Hall explores exactly what it means when your faith and your life collide, and how you can take the next steps in making that faith real and evident to those around you.
